School Summary
South Carolina Connections Academy (SCCA) is a tuition-free, K–12 online public school. The school was launched in 2008–09 under contract to the South Carolina Connections Academy Charter School. SCCA is South Carolina’s very first virtual charter school, authorized by the Erskine Charter School District. The school serves students in grades K–12 from anywhere in South Carolina.
